Music is one of my favorite things in the world. It has become one of the several ways that I am able to express myself and my emotions. The band that has helped me most is My Chemical Romance. This is the band that I wasn’t expecting to be a saving grace during one of the hardest times in my life. The first song I ever listened to was “Fake Your Death,” one of their upbeat songs that made me fall in love with their music.

It isn’t the beat that made me return to their music time and time again, it was the lyrics. Each time I listened to their music, it felt like I was with a group of friends who didn’t know what I was going through. Yet, they understood the words I couldn’t seem to speak.

My Chemical Romance taught me that it’s okay to feel the many emotions that have a habit of swirling around in your mind. To me, each album represents a different emotion, expressing that in their songs.

Not only do I love their music, I love the message they stand for. My Chemical Romance is a group of male activists for those who suffer from mental illnesses, suicidal thoughts, depression, and anxiety. It is not often that I come across a band that wants to help people through their hard times, which is partly why I like them so much. They know what it is like because they went through it too.

This band has given me hope that I will be able to get through whatever it is I am going through. And that there are four guys just as messed up as I am.
